Abstract
A skateboard, having a platform and a pair of roller assemblies mounted respectively at opposed longitudinal ends of the platform. One of its roller assemblies has a rotatable axle and a pair of wheels fixedly secured thereto for conjoint rotation. A chain extends below the platform and is entrained upwardly through spaced holes for grasping by the user. A transmission is secured to the rotatable axle and is actuated by the movement of the chain to rotate the axle and thus propel the skateboard.
